Delivered to the USAF in 1976, started to serve the 1st Tactical Fighter Wing ('FF') at Langley (VA), was transferred in the late seventies to the 58th Tactical Training Wing ('LA') at Luke (AZ) and from 1984 the 325th TTW ('TY') at Tyndal (FL) (as pictured). The Eagle was flown to AMARC on 22 September 1992 and received inventory code FH0040. On 3 February 2009, the F-15 was moved to HVF West, Tucson (AZ) and scrapped.
